🤝 The Power of Negotiation: Your Path to Debt Relief

Negotiating with creditors involves advocating for yourself to secure more favorable terms on your debts. Here’s how you can navigate this process:

💡 Negotiating Lower Interest Rates

  1. Gather Information: Understand your current interest rates and research prevailing rates for similar financial products.
  2. Prepare a Pitch: Clearly articulate your financial situation, highlighting reasons you deserve a lower rate.
  3. Contact Your Creditor: Reach out to your creditor and express your intention to continue repaying but with improved terms.
  4. Be Persistent: Negotiations may require patience. Don’t hesitate to escalate to supervisors if needed.

🤝 Tips for Debt Settlement Negotiations

  1. Assess Your Finances: Determine a reasonable amount you can offer to settle your debt.
  2. Propose a Settlement: Present your proposal to the creditor, explaining your financial hardship and the benefits of accepting your offer.
  3. Get It in Writing: If an agreement is reached, ensure all terms are documented in writing before making any payments.
  4. Consider Professional Help: If negotiations become complex, seek assistance from a credit counselor or debt relief agency.
